    Quote Originally Posted by MrRogue View Post
    I have not acc3essed the site in over three months ...

    At this time I can NOT access the website because of the password has been outdated. NOT A COOL FEATURE !!!
    It hasn't deleted your old password. It's simply requiring you to CHANGE it for standard ecommerce industry security reasons.

    Quote Originally Posted by MrRogue View Post
    It asks for my old and then to type the "new password" twice.
    Yes, that's normal. Standard procedure for changing a password.

    Quote Originally Posted by MrRogue View Post
    It's NOT working.
    It would be helpful if you explained more about what you mean by "not working".
    Is it one of:
    - "a big read screen pops up saying 'hey, I'm not working'"?
    - an error message appears somewhere, likely saying your new password isn't of an expected format? What IS the exact error message?
    - is the screen refreshing and asking for the same thing again, without any error message?

    It's really hard to help out when insufficient information is provided.
